Glycine Goes In, Your Hands Get Warm, and Your Core Temperature Takes the Hint

Falling asleep looks like the brain powering down. Mechanically, a good chunk of it is plumbing. Your core temperature has to drop by roughly a degree before your brain will sign off on sleep, and the body pulls that off by pushing warm blood out toward the hands and feet to shed heat. Glycine, the smallest amino acid on the roster, happens to work that exact valve.

Glycine is not exotic. It is a non-essential amino acid, which is a polite way of saying your body makes its own and does not need you fussing over it. It is the main building block of collagen, it moonlights as a neurotransmitter, and you already eat three to five grams of it a day in bone broth, meat, eggs, beans and spinach. Nobody sells spinach as a sleep aid, but the glycine in it did not get that memo.

Here is the part worth the ticket. The suprachiasmatic nucleus is the master clock buried in your hypothalamus, the thing that decides when you feel awake and when you feel like furniture. Glycine acts on NMDA receptors sitting inside that clock. When it does, the body opens blood flow to the skin and the extremities, warm blood radiates heat out through your hands and feet, and core temperature slides down. In a 2015 rat study, glycine raised blood flow to the paws, dropped core temperature, and increased non-REM sleep. Lesion the suprachiasmatic nucleus and the whole effect vanishes, which is how the researchers knew the clock was the middleman and not a bystander.

Warm hands, cool core, and the brain files that under bedtime. It is the same trick as a warm bath an hour before bed. You heat the surface so the center can dump heat and cool off.

The human evidence is smaller but points the same way. In a 2007 study using overnight polysomnography, people who took three grams of glycine before bed fell asleep faster, reached deep slow-wave sleep faster, and rated their sleep as better, with no distortion of sleep architecture on the machine. Translation: it did not drug them into a strange sleep, it just got them to the normal one quicker. A 2012 trial took the meaner route and cut volunteers' sleep short for three nights straight. The glycine group came out less wrecked the next day, scoring better on vigilance and memory tasks than the placebo group. An earlier 2006 study reported the same bump in subjective sleep quality.

Now the honest part, because a supplement with nothing but good news is usually hiding something. These human studies are small, and several were run by researchers connected to a company that makes glycine. That does not make the results fake, but it does mean the evidence is early rather than settled, and the temperature mechanism is still mostly animal work. Glycine is also not a sedative. It will not hit you like a prescription sleep drug, and if you are waiting to be clobbered, you will be let down. It nudges. For a lot of people, a nudge was the missing piece.

Dose and timing are refreshingly boring. The studies used three grams, taken thirty to sixty minutes before bed. That amount was well tolerated with no real side effects, while much larger doses can bring on nausea, which is your body asking you to reread the label. It is also not a fix for a bedroom that is too warm, a phone in your face, or a 4 p.m. espresso, all of which will beat glycine in a fair fight.

One point of confusion worth clearing up: glycine and magnesium glycinate are not the same thing. Magnesium glycinate is magnesium bonded to glycine for gentler absorption. Plain glycine is just the amino acid, and it is cheap. Some people pair it with L-theanine for the wind-down, and glycine's day job building collagen means it stays busy whether or not you are asleep.
